save your money and get a quantum incyte. theyre about 50 bucks and i love mine. its almost 3 yrs old now and it still feels and sounds like new. im not overly nice to my reels either. it handles braid well and its drag is silk. incyte is the reel jut below the pt series and has all the features in a graphite frame. 11 bearings two spools etc. and the graphite never flexs cause its a slimline type frame.
best reel for the money i ever got.

I've got two of the older Mega-Lites. They had problems with the anti-reverse gear - they were made with cheap metal parts that corroded easily. I was able to get anti-reverse replacement parts for both the Mega-Lites I own and have had no problems since. I've used them for 4-5 years now in freshwater only. The drag is excellent.
